 | //------------------------------------------------------------------------- | 
 | // CommandObjectApropos | 
 | //------------------------------------------------------------------------- | 
 |  | 
 | CommandObjectApropos::CommandObjectApropos(CommandInterpreter &interpreter) | 
 |     : CommandObjectParsed( | 
 |           interpreter, "apropos", | 
 |           "List debugger commands related to a word or subject.", nullptr) { | 
 |   CommandArgumentEntry arg; | 
 |   CommandArgumentData search_word_arg; | 
 |  | 
 |   // Define the first (and only) variant of this arg. | 
 |   search_word_arg.arg_type = eArgTypeSearchWord; | 
 |   search_word_arg.arg_repetition = eArgRepeatPlain; | 
 |  | 
 |   // There is only one variant this argument could be; put it into the argument | 
 |   // entry. | 
 |   arg.push_back(search_word_arg); | 
 |  | 
 |   // Push the data for the first argument into the m_arguments vector. | 
 |   m_arguments.push_back(arg);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| CommandObjectApropos::~CommandObjectApropos() = default; | 
 |  | 
 | bool CommandObjectApropos::DoExecute(Args &args, CommandReturnObject &result) { | 
 |   const size_t argc = args.GetArgumentCount(); | 
 |  | 
 |   if (argc == 1) { | 
 |     auto search_word = args[0].ref; | 
 |     if (!search_word.empty()) { | 
 |       // The bulk of the work must be done inside the Command Interpreter, | 
 |       // since the command dictionary is private. | 
 |       StringList commands_found; | 
 |       StringList commands_help; | 
 |  | 
 |       m_interpreter.FindCommandsForApropos(search_word, commands_found, | 
 |                                            commands_help, true, true, true); | 
 |  | 
 |       if (commands_found.GetSize() == 0) { | 
 |         result.AppendMessageWithFormat("No commands found pertaining to '%s'. " | 
 |                                        "Try 'help' to see a complete list of " | 
 |                                        "debugger commands.\n", | 
 |                                        args[0].c_str()); | 
 |       } else { | 
 |         if (commands_found.GetSize() > 0) { | 
 |           result.AppendMessageWithFormat( | 
 |               "The following commands may relate to '%s':\n", args[0].c_str()); | 
 |           size_t max_len = 0; | 
 |  | 
 |           for (size_t i = 0; i < commands_found.GetSize(); ++i) { | 
 |             size_t len = strlen(commands_found.GetStringAtIndex(i)); | 
 |             if (len > max_len) | 
 |               max_len = len; | 
 |           } | 
 |  | 
 |           for (size_t i = 0; i < commands_found.GetSize(); ++i) | 
 |             m_interpreter.OutputFormattedHelpText( | 
 |                 result.GetOutputStream(), commands_found.GetStringAtIndex(i), | 
 |                 "--", commands_help.GetStringAtIndex(i), max_len); | 
 |         } | 
 |       } | 
 |  | 
 |       std::vector<const Property *> properties; | 
 |       const size_t num_properties = | 
 |           m_interpreter.GetDebugger().Apropos(search_word, properties); | 
 |       if (num_properties) { | 
 |         const bool dump_qualified_name = true; | 
 |         result.AppendMessageWithFormatv( | 
 |             "\nThe following settings variables may relate to '{0}': \n\n", | 
 |             args[0].ref); | 
 |         for (size_t i = 0; i < num_properties; ++i) | 
 |           properties[i]->DumpDescription( | 
 |               m_interpreter, result.GetOutputStream(), 0, dump_qualified_name); | 
 |       } | 
 |  | 
 |       result.SetStatus(eReturnStatusSuccessFinishNoResult); | 
 |     } else { | 
 |       result.AppendError("'' is not a valid search word.\n"); | 
 |       result.SetStatus(eReturnStatusFailed); | 
 |     } | 
 |   } else { | 
 |     result.AppendError("'apropos' must be called with exactly one argument.\n"); | 
 |     result.SetStatus(eReturnStatusFailed); |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   return result.Succeeded(); | 
 | } |
